I've had Comcast/Xfinity, Time Warner, Google Fiber and AT&T within the last year IN the Olathe and Shawnee area. Xfinity has the best product for the money IMO. However, horrid support. They did something about 2 or 3 years ago that made their service eons better and WAY more affordable.

Google Fiber is the best if you want to pay for it. Followed by Comcast, then AT&T and finally Time Warner.

I had Time Warner for the last 9 months up until yesterday. I paid for 300 mbps. I could sit right by the router and get only 20-40 mbps. Now I pay for AT&T for ONLY 45 mbps, and ACTUALLY get 45 mbps. Wirelss N or AC, don't matter. I would routinely get 120 mbps on Comcast even with the router 2 stories up in my house.

FOR the exact same service that uses 4-5 TVs, 2 DVRs, higher tier internet, cable packages including ESPNU, ESPN News, CBS Sports Network etc
Google Fiber $157
Direct TV & AT&T $115
Comcast $108
Time Warner $193

Why ANYONE would have Time Warner is beyond me. HORRIBLE pricing. Outdated equipment. However, they were the best customer service besides Google.
